Product Description:
Butyl 3-mercaptopropionate is widely used in the polymer industry as a chain transfer agent. It helps control the molecular weight of polymers during the polymerization process, ensuring the production of materials with desired properties. This chemical is particularly valuable in the synthesis of acrylic polymers and resins, where it improves processability and enhances the final product's performance. Additionally, it is employed in the production of adhesives, coatings, and sealants, contributing to their durability and flexibility. Its ability to act as a sulfur donor also makes it useful in certain chemical reactions and organic synthesis processes.
